Understanding the Role of a Denturist

Before diving into the process, it's essential to understand the role of a denturist. A denturist is a dental specialist who focuses on the fabrication, fitting, and maintenance of dentures. With their expertise, they can guide you through each step of the denture journey, ensuring the best possible outcome for you.

Step 1: Consultation and Assessment

The denture journey typically begins with a consultation and assessment with a denturist. During this initial appointment, the denturist will examine your mouth, discuss your dental history, and listen to your concerns and goals. They will take impressions and measurements to create custom-made dentures that fit perfectly in your mouth.

Step 2: Preparing for Dentures

After the initial consultation, the denturist will guide you through the process of preparing for dentures. This may involve extracting any remaining teeth if necessary and providing instructions on oral hygiene to maintain a healthy mouth before receiving dentures. In some cases, the denturist may recommend temporary dentures to ensure your comfort and functionality during the healing process.

Step 3: Fitting and Adjustments

Once your mouth is ready, the denturist will begin the fitting process. They will carefully place the dentures in your mouth, making necessary adjustments to ensure a comfortable and natural fit. It's common to experience some discomfort or soreness initially, but a denturist will work closely with you to address any concerns and make the necessary adjustments to improve comfort.

Step 4: Post-Treatment Care and Maintenance

Receiving dentures is just the beginning. Proper care and maintenance are crucial to ensure the longevity and functionality of your dentures. The denturist will provide guidance on cleaning techniques, diet modifications, and regular check-ups to keep your dentures in optimal condition. They will also be available to address any concerns or provide repairs if needed.

Step 5: Adjusting to Dentures

Adapting to dentures may take some time, and it's normal to experience a period of adjustment. The denturist will offer advice and support during this transition phase, providing tips on speaking, eating, and maintaining confidence with your new dentures. They will work closely with you to ensure that any discomfort or issues are resolved, allowing you to fully enjoy the benefits of your new teeth.
